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
66092867 083 902498 419
478 77833074912 3128642
478 77833074912 3128642
830940624 331704 45925370755
All about undefined
Interested in learning more?
478 77833074912 3128642
830940624 331704 45925370755
See more
498 7641848998
4888192 9186 21 009707227 0330266
See more
47935912 69710997736 63
563 84 3388533063
See more